Like the seder itself, this medley packs in a whole sequence of events. Sing along with your favorite tunes and enjoy the ones that are new to you as the cantors share their favorite Passover melodies. Wishing you a Shabbat shalom and hag sameah!
Featuring: Cantors Azi Schwartz and Mira Davis
Music: Various arranged by Stephen Glass
Music director: David Enlow
AV: Oscar Acevedo, Terrell Simms, Oli Jung
